Preview: Liverpool vs. Besiktas

Sports Mole looks ahead to the Europa League round of 32 opening leg between Liverpool and Besiktas.

The juggling act starts for Brendan Rodgers and Liverpool on Thursday evening as they play host to Besiktas in the first leg of the Europa League's round of 32.

The Reds started this season in the Champions League, but a third-placed finish behind Real Madrid and Basel in the group stages resulted in Rodgers's men being demoted to Europe's second competition.

Now, as his side battles to seal a return to the Champions League next term, Rodgers will have to find the right balance between ties on a Thursday night and Premier League matches on a Sunday afternoon.

Those circumstances could result in some alterations being made to the starting lineup ahead of the trip to Southampton at the weekend.

Mario Balotelli, Dejan Lovren and Glen Johnson have been tipped to earn recalls, but Steven Gerrard, Raheem Sterling and Lucas are all carrying knocks and may well not be risked.

Lazar Markovic will also play no part at Anfield because of a suspension, which he has been handed as a result of the red card that he received last time out in Europe against Basel.

Meanwhile, the visiting Turks will be without senior goalkeeper Tolga Zengin because of a knee injury, but Demba Ba is fit and available to lead the attack.

On Ba's previous visit to Merseyside last April, the Senegalese frontman benefited from a Gerrard slip to score for Chelsea, who ran out 2-0 victors. It was a result that went a long way to ending Liverpool's hopes of securing a first league title since 1990.

His current employers, though, did not have such good luck during their last trip to Anfield in 2007. The two sides met in the group stages of the Champions League, with Rafael Benitez's Liverpool running out 8-0 winners. It's a scoreline that remains Besiktas's heaviest European defeat.

In total, Liverpool have met Turkish opposition on 10 occasions, winning five times and drawing twice.
